What the BON CHARGE LED Mask Claims to Do

The mask uses clinically studied wavelengths of light, including:

  • Red Light (around 630–660nm) – stimulates collagen production, helps with fine lines, improves overall skin tone

  • Blue Light – targets acne-causing bacteria

  • Near-Infrared Light – supports deeper skin repair and inflammation reduction

The brand markets it as medical-grade, with strong light output compared to cheaper alternatives. It’s wireless, rechargeable, and designed for at-home use.


How I Used It

I used the mask 4–5 times per week for 10–20 minutes per session.

My routine:

  1. Cleanse

  2. Pat dry (completely dry skin)

  3. Use red light most days

  4. Use blue light 2–3 times per week when I felt breakouts coming

  5. Apply skincare after the session

It became part of my wind-down routine. Low lighting, mask on, podcast playing. Kind of therapeutic honestly.


Week-by-Week Results

Week 1: Subtle but Promising

I didn’t expect miracles immediately — and I didn’t get them. But I did notice something interesting.

After each session, my skin looked calmer. Redness was visibly reduced for a few hours. It almost gave that post-facial glow without the exfoliation.

Breakouts weren’t gone, but inflammation around active pimples seemed less angry. My skin felt slightly smoother to the touch.

Nothing dramatic yet — but no irritation, no dryness, no sensitivity. That was a good sign.


Week 2: Texture Shift

Around the two-week mark, I started seeing real change in texture.

My forehead felt smoother. Those tiny bumps that show up under certain lighting? Reduced. Not erased, but noticeably softened.

I also noticed:

  • Breakouts healing faster

  • Less lingering redness from old acne

  • Makeup sitting better on my skin

The biggest shift was in overall tone. My complexion looked more even — less blotchy.


Week 3: The Glow Era

This was when I understood the LED hype.

My skin had this steady, healthy glow — not oily shine, but actual radiance. I caught myself skipping foundation more often.

Fine lines around my eyes looked softer. Again, not erased, but slightly blurred. My jawline area felt firmer, especially in the mornings.

Hormonal breakouts still happened, but:

  • They were smaller

  • Less inflamed

  • Healed faster

  • Left lighter marks behind

The blue light sessions seemed to genuinely reduce the intensity of acne flare-ups.


Week 4: Cumulative Results

By day 30, the changes were undeniable.

What Improved Most:

  • Skin smoothness

  • Redness reduction

  • Healing time of breakouts

  • Overall glow

  • Mild firming effect

My acne scars looked lighter. My pores (especially around my nose) appeared tighter. My skin felt stronger and healthier overall.

It wasn’t a dramatic overnight transformation. It was more like steady, quiet improvement that built over time.
